The medical term for two or more fingers or toes that are fused together or webbed is syndactyly (sin- dak -t uh -lee). In humans it is considered unusual, occurring in approximately one in 2,000 to 2,500 live births. This is normal in many birds, such as ducks amphibians, such as frogs and mammals, such as kangaroos. It is characterised by the fusion of two or more digits of the feet. Syndactyly is usually not painful and does not effects someone’s ability to walk or run however may prevent them from wearing certain shoes comfortably and may cause some to be self-conscious about how their feet look.
